Quick no-start checklist (before we arrive)

These quick checks can help us diagnose faster. If anything feels unsafe, skip the checks and WhatsApp us.

Do you hear clicking?

Often battery-related or starter motor draw issues. Note if it’s a single click or rapid clicks.

Do the lights go dim?

Dim lights can indicate low battery charge or poor terminal contact.

Does it crank slowly?

Slow cranking can point to battery weakness, starter motor load, or cable issues.

Any warning lights?

If warning lights are on, diagnostics helps pinpoint the exact cause.

Most common reasons a car won’t start in Cape Town

Weak / failed battery

The most common cause — especially if the car was unused or used for short trips.

Starter motor issues

Clicks, intermittent start, or slow crank even with a good battery.

Alternator not charging

Car starts then battery dies later — or battery keeps going flat repeatedly.

Terminal / wiring faults

Loose terminals or corrosion can mimic major faults but are often quick to fix.

Immobiliser symptoms

Starts then cuts, or no crank with dash lights behaving unusually.

Fault codes / sensor issues

Some vehicles won’t start if certain critical sensors fail — diagnostics helps confirm.

Why cars fail to start in Cape Town (local patterns)

In Cape Town, we commonly see no-start situations caused by short-trip driving, older batteries,
and charging systems that slowly weaken over time. Many vehicles are used for quick commutes,
which doesn’t always give the battery enough time to recharge fully.

Weather changes, humidity near coastal areas, and stop-start traffic can also contribute to
electrical wear. The key is diagnosing correctly before replacing parts unnecessarily.

Clicking vs Cranking vs No Response — What It Means

Rapid Clicking

Usually a weak battery or poor connection. Voltage drops too low to crank the engine.

Slow Crank

Engine turns over slowly. Could be battery strain, starter motor resistance, or cable issues.

No Crank at All

Possible starter motor failure, immobiliser issue, or wiring fault.

Starts Then Dies

Often charging-related. The alternator may not be keeping the battery charged.

When it’s safe to try starting again — and when it’s not

If the vehicle only clicks once and all lights are very dim, repeated attempts can completely drain the battery.
In that case, it’s better to stop trying and contact us.

If the engine cranks normally but doesn’t fire, further testing is required.
Avoid pushing the vehicle unless it is in a safe area.

Preventing future no-start issues

Many no-start situations are preventable with routine servicing and battery health checks.
Vehicles that sit unused for long periods are especially prone to battery drain.

  • Replace batteries proactively every 3–4 years
  • Service the vehicle at recommended intervals
  • Avoid repeated short trips without longer drives
  • Address warning lights early
  • Book periodic inspections if the vehicle is older
